Two courses from the following: ACCT 201.Supply Chain Management (SCM) is the collection of critical business functions that enable companies to create, produce, and deliver products and services. SCM activities include operations planning, procurement and sourcing, production of goods and services, demand fulfillment, transportation and logistics, and the various customer support and ...The Tepper School offers several minor options for students interested in studying business - Business Administration, Business Analytics and Optimization, Financial Management, Product Management, and Operations and Supply Chain Management. OM 483B Supply Chain Management Case Study Analysis 3 Credit Hours. The purpose of this experiential learning course is to teach students how to understand, analyze, and solve business case studies in the field of operations and supply chain management. The business case study is a powerful learning tool used in many business schools.
